Two fannie/freddie private mortgage insurance (pmi) options are worth exploring at the 5-percent down payment level. Borrower paid PMI is when the mortgage insurance is a separate line item. Lender paid PMI is when your rate is higher in exchange for the mortgage insurance being built into the rate.
